Transaction 3f95703a40b21e8176b2b6d649fb062a516c7b15a383691501769dd12bdc8a82

1 Input
2 Outputs
  • 3f95703a40b21e8176b2b6d649fb062a516c7b15a383691501769dd12bdc8a82:0
  • value  1000000
    address  137FiVoE1F7ovTDkhEpBNcGLUzPD3FMHtw
  • 3f95703a40b21e8176b2b6d649fb062a516c7b15a383691501769dd12bdc8a82:1
  • value  1143862
    address  12swftGSjg4aWVudumuvbm4F6nPwvb9X7F